/* Hintergrund Farbe (der Seite auf welcher der Rechner eingebunden werden soll) */
	.fa_hintergrund
	{
	background-color: #FFFFFF;		
	}

.form-td {font-size:13px;font-weight:bold;color:#504F4F;}

	
	
/* Titelleisten */
	.fa_rahmen
	{
	background-color: #035a28;
	color: #FFFFFF;
	font-family: Arial, Helvetica;
	font-size: 14px;
	font-weight: bold;
	text-align: left;	
	padding:3px;
	}
	
/* Formular */
	.fa_formzeile
	{
	background-color: #EEEEEE;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-weight: normal;
	color: #000000;	
	}
	
	.fa_formzelle
	{
	background-color: #EEEEEE;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-weight: normal;
	color: #000000;	
	}
	
	.fa_form_select_rechner
	{
	}

/* Formular Button */
	.fa_button
	{
	font-size: 12px;
	font-family: arial, helvetica;
	color: #FFFFFF;
	background-color: #035a28;
	border-width: 0px;
	}
	
/* Ergebnistabelle - Titelzeile */
	.fa_headzeile
	{
	background-color: #EEEEEE;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-weight: normal;
	color: #000000;	
	}
	
	.fa_headzelle
	{
	}
	
/* Ergebnistabelle */
/* Ergebnistabelle - gerade Zeilen */
	.fa_zeile_th
	{
	background-color: #EEEEEE;
	font-family: Arial, Helvetica;
	font-size: 13px;
	font-weight: normal;
	color: #000000;	
	text-decoration: none;
	}
	
	.fa_zeile
	{
	background-color: #EEEEEE;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-weight: normal;
	color: #000000;	
	text-decoration: none;
	}
	
/* Ergebnistabelle - ungerade Zeilen */
	.fa_zeile2
	{
	background-color: #DDDDDD;
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-weight: normal;
	color: #000000;	
	text-decoration: none;
	}

/* Ergebnistabelle - Zellen */
	.fa_zelle
	{
	font-family: Arial, Helvetica;
	font-size: 12px;
	font-weight: normal;	
	}
	
/* Ergebnistabelle - Logospalte */
	.fa_logotd
	{
	}
	
/* Ergebnistabelle - Logo */
	.fa_logoimg
	{
	border-width: 0px;
	}
	

/* Links */
	.fa_link
	{
	font-size: 12px;
	font-family: Arial, Helvetica;
	color: #CB0000;
	text-decoration: none;
	}
	
	.fa_productlink
	{
	font-size: 12px;
	font-family: Arial, Helvetica;
	color: #CB0000;
	text-decoration: none;
	}
	
	.fa_link:hover
	{
	color: #da4c4c;
	text-decoration: underline;
	}
	
/* Anmerkungen */	
	.fa_footnotes
	{
	color: #444444;
	font-size: 10px;
	font-family: arial, helvetica;
	}
	
/* Info PopUp */
	.fa_body
	{
	font-family: arial, helvetica;
	font-size: 11px;
	color: #000000;
	background-color: #EEEEEE;
	border: 1px solid #CB0000;
	margin: 0px;
	padding: 4px;
	width: 180px;
	}

	.fa_header
	{
	font-family: arial, helvetica;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#CB0000;
	border: 1px solid #CB0000;
	margin: 0px;
	padding: 4px;
	width: 180px;
	}
	
	.info_body{font-family:arial, helvetica;font-size:11px;color:#000000;background-color:#dddddd;border:1px solid #a9a6a6;margin:0px;padding:4px;width:250px;text-align:left;}

	.info_header{font-family:arial, helvetica;font-size:11px;font-weight:bold;color:#000000;background-color:#dddddd;border-left:1px solid #a9a6a6;border-top:1px solid #a9a6a6;border-right:1px solid #a9a6a6;margin:0px;padding:4px;width:250px;}
	.fa_info_body{font-family:arial, helvetica;font-size:11px;color:#000000;background-color:#dddddd;border:1px solid #a9a6a6;margin:0px;padding:4px;width:250px;text-align:left;}

	.fa_info_header{font-family:arial, helvetica;font-size:11px;font-weight:bold;color:#000000;background-color:#dddddd;border-left:1px solid #a9a6a6;border-top:1px solid #a9a6a6;border-right:1px solid #a9a6a6;margin:0px;padding:4px;width:250px;}

	
/* Tipps Kennzeichnen */
	
	.top-product td {		
		border-top: 2px solid #CB0000 !important;
		border-bottom: 2px solid #CB0000 !important;
	}

/* Formular Felder */

	.depotrechner_ordervolumen,
	.depotrechner_orderanzahl,
	.depotrechner_depotvolumen,
	.depotrechner_orderinternet,
	.festgeldrechner_anlagebetrag,
	.girokontorechner_zahlungseingang,
	.girokontorechner_guthaben,
	.girokontorechner_minus,
	.kreditkarterechner_umsatzeuroland,
	.kreditkarterechner_umsatznichteuroland,
	.ratenkreditrechner_kreditbetrag,
	.tagesgeldrechner_anlagebetrag
	{
	width: 60px;	
	}
	
	.girokontorechner_minustage
	{
	width: 40px;
	}
	
	.kreditkarterechner_kartengesellschaft,
	.kreditkarterechner_anzeige,
	.kreditkarterechner_zahlungsart
	{
	width: 150px;
	}
	
	.festgeldrechner_laufzeit,
	.girokontorechner_berufsgruppe,
	.girokontorechner_guthabentage,
	.girokontorechner_eckarte,
	.girokontorechner_kreditkarte,
	.girokontorechner_use_regional,
	.girokontorechner_regional,
	.girokontorechner_filialbanken,
	.ratenkreditrechner_laufzeit,
	.ratenkreditrechner_verwendungszweck,
	.tagesgeldrechner_laufzeit
	{
	
	}

	.fa_incentive{text-align:center;margin:0px;padding:4px 0px 0px 0px;vertical-align:middle;}
	
	.vgl-button1 {
    -moz-border-bottom-colors: none;
    -moz-border-left-colors: none;
    -moz-border-right-colors: none;
    -moz-border-top-colors: none;
    background: -moz-linear-gradient(center top , #00521d, #1d8241) repeat scroll 0 0 transparent;	
	background:-ms-linear-gradient(top,#00521d 30%,#1d8241 75%);
	background:-webkit-linear-gradient(top,#00521d 30%,#1d8241 75%);
	background:-o-linear-gradient(top,#00521d 30%,#1d8241 75%);
	fil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#00521d', endColorstr='#1d8241');	
    border-color: rgba(0, 0, 0, 0.2) rgba(0, 0, 0, 0.2) rgba(0, 0, 0, 0.4);
    border-image: none;
    border-radius: 4px 4px 4px 4px;
    border-style: solid;
    border-width: 1px;
    box-shadow: 0 1px 2px rgba(0, 0, 0, 0.2);
    color: #FFFFFF;
    cursor: pointer;
    display: inline-block;
    font-size: 14px;
    padding: 4px 10px 4px 10px;
    text-align: center;
    text-decoration: none;
    vertical-align: middle;
}


.vgl-button1.submit {
	padding: 6px 15px;
	background: #1d8241;
	background: -webkit-gradient(linear,left top,left bottom,from(#00521d),to(#1d8241));
	background: -moz-linear-gradient(top,#00521d,#1d8241);
	background: -o-linear-gradient(#00521d,#1d8241);
	fil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#00521d', endColorstr='#1d8241');
}

.vgl-button1:hover {
	background: #1d8241;
	color: #fff;
	text-decoration:none:
}

.vgl-button1:visited {
	color: #fff;
	text-decoration:none:
}

.vgl-button1.submit:hover {
	background: #1d8241;
}

.vgl-button1 img {
	padding-left:3px;
	border:0;
}

.fa_li_leistungen {
	margin:0;
}

ul{display:block;list-style-type:square;margin-bottom:20px;margin-left:5px;padding-left:20px}
li{margin-bottom:5px;font-size:12px}
.fa_footnotes{color:#444444;font-size:10px;font-family:Arial;}